Session #56 802. 16 Relay TG Closing Remarks and Session Summary 14 th Task Group Meeting on Multi-hop Relay in IEEE 802. 16 Relay TG Chair Mitsuo Nohara Vice Chair Peiying Zhu Technical Editor/Secretary Jung Je Son Technical Editor Mike Hart IEEE 802. 16 Relay TG Meeting 14 -17 July, 2008, Denver, Colorado, USA

Comment Resolution Done • WG Letter Ballot #28 d on Draft, IEEE P 802.

Comment Resolution Done • WG Letter Ballot #28 d on Draft, IEEE P 802. 16 j/D 5 • 188 Comments submitted • Including 4 late comments • Comment Resolutions • 188 Resolved in Meeting #56 • Results in 802. 16 -08/033 r 2 All Comments resolved 97 Accepted 40 Accept-Modified 19 Rejected 32 Superceded 188 Total 3

Schedule towards Sponsor Ballot Conditions: • Confirmation Ballot requires two-weeks for circulation • Sponsor

Schedule towards Sponsor Ballot Conditions: • Confirmation Ballot requires two-weeks for circulation • Sponsor Ballot requires 30 days for circulation Timelines: (modified from the one presented at the WG Opening Plenary) • • • TG Editors to revise the draft (to be D 6), 22 July – 6 Aug. : Confirmation Ballot, 8 Aug. : Submit the package to EC for Sponsor Ballot 15 Aug. – 14 Sept. : Sponsor Ballot, and 16 -19 Sept. : Comment resolutions @Kobe session

Motions at Relay TG Closing 1. To authorize the Technical Editors to revise the draft (P 802. 16 j/D 5) to accommodate the comment resolutions in 802. 16 -08/033 r 2. • Motion 1 st: Kerstin Johnsson, 2 nd: Dorin Viorel, at 16: 33, passed 16/0/0 2. To authorize the TG Chair to request the working group approve P 802. 16 j/D 6 as revised draft and to proceed to the confirmation ballot. • Motion 1 st: Kanchei Loa, 2 nd: Gamini Senarath, at 16: 35, passed 16/0/0 3. To authorize the TG Chair to request the working group approve to proceed to EC’s conditional approval to initiate Sponsor Ballot on P 802. 16 j/D 6 or latest version, closing that ballot before session #57, if possible. • Motion 1 st: Avner Aloush, 2 nd: Kanchei Loa, at 16: 36 passed 16/0/0 4. To authorize the TG Chair to request the working group approve to allow WG Chair and Relay TG Chair Team to resolve comments in Confirmation Ballot. • Motion 1 st: Kerstin Johnsson, 2 nd: Dorin Viorel, at 16: 39 9 passed 17/0/0
